Analysis

The most recent figure for jordan — sawnwood, coniferous — export quantity in Bosnia and Herzegovina is 1,214 m3, measured in 2018. That is the highest value across all 7 years on record.

The figure is up 249.9% on the previous year and up 754.9% over ten years.

Bosnia and Herzegovina ranks 10th of 22 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

Jordan — Sawnwood, coniferous — Export Quantity in Bosnia and Herzegovina, year by year

Annual values for Jordan — Sawnwood, coniferous — Export Quantity in Bosnia and Herzegovina, 2012 to 2018.
Year m3 Change
2012 142 m3
2013 333 m3 +134.5%
2014 550 m3 +65.2%
2015 582 m3 +5.8%
2016 954 m3 +63.9%
2017 347 m3 -63.6%
2018 1,214 m3 +249.9%

The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
